Output d59a71c13b55b44ee5cdcff65841e8a87caf5a89d8e41240fe6cfbcd6f8d1280:0

value
93634
script pubkey
OP_0 OP_PUSHBYTES_20 103f1d5bf1d894423f957b68a144857c53ea01a3
address
bc1qzql36kl3mz2yy0u40d52z3y903f75qdrwdqnlt
transaction
d59a71c13b55b44ee5cdcff65841e8a87caf5a89d8e41240fe6cfbcd6f8d1280
confirmations
85444
spent
true